linux的shell脚本接收参数
#接收变量
for parm in "$@"
do
key=`echo ${parm%%=*}`
value=`echo ${parm#*=}`
if [ $key == "--job_name" ];then
export JOB_NAME=$value
fi
if [ $key == "--filename" ];then
export FILENAME=$value
fi
done
#接收变量
for parm in "$@"
do
key=`echo ${parm%%=*}`
value=`echo ${parm#*=}`
if [ $key == "--job_name" ];then
export JOB_NAME=$value
fi
if [ $key == "--filename" ];then
export FILENAME=$value
fi
done
文章目录 执行shell文件: 输出重定向 创建一个hello.sh文件: 执行:sh hello.sh param1 param2。 示例
文章目录 shell传递参数 方式一 本章内容主要讲解如何在shell脚本外部传递参数,比如杀死进程命令: `kill -9 进程号`,那么如何
大家都知道普通的bash命令后边可以跟任意的参数,那我们自己编写的脚本是否也支持传递参数呢?答案当然是肯定的 执行“vim test.sh”创建一个新的shell脚本。脚本t
接收变量 for parm in "$@" do key=`echo ${parm%%=}` value=`echo ${p
一个简单例子 para.sh \\\\\\\\\\\\\\\\\\\\\\\\ \!/bin/sh \scriptname:para echo
1. \! /bin/sh 2. 3. default\_route=$(ip route show) 4. defaul
> 在许多的情况下,Shell脚本都需要接受用户的输入,根据用户的输入参数来执行不同的操作。本节内容主要介绍Shell脚本的参数,以及如何在脚本中接收参数。 Shell脚本
建表sql语句: SET FOREIGN_KEY_CHECKS=0; -- ---------------------------- -
[Shell][]中的内部变量: $?: 表示shell命令的返回值. $$: 表示当前shell的pid. $!: 最后一个放入后台作业的PID值.
第一个参数用$1表示,第二个参数用$2表示,以此类推。。 写一个简单的传参数脚本来测试: \!/bin/bash if \[ $1 =="start" \] the
还没有评论,来说两句吧...